That's a piece of cake: $ cd /usr/ports/ $ rm -rf x11/krusader $ cvs up -d x11/krusader cvs server: Updating x11/krusader cvs server: Updating x11/krusader/patches cvs server: Updating x11/krusader/pkg When updating these two directories, pay attention to *not* specify the -P option. Make sure you do *not* have "update -P" in your .cvsrc, even though that is useful in most cases, but, as you see, not in all. The point here is to check out these two directories even though they are currently empty. A mere "mkdir -p x11/krusader/pkg" would not be sufficient because it would not create the administrative directories x11/krusader/CVS and x11/krusader/pkg/CVS. $ tar -xzvf krusader.tar.gz x11/krusader x11/krusader/Makefile x11/krusader/distinfo x11/krusader/pkg x11/krusader/pkg/DESCR x11/krusader/pkg/PLIST $ cd x11/krusader $ cvs add Makefile distinfo pkg/DESCR pkg/PLIST cvs server: re-adding file Makefile (in place of dead revision 1.27) cvs server: re-adding file distinfo (in place of dead revision 1.3) cvs server: re-adding file pkg/DESCR (in place of dead revision 1.2) cvs server: re-adding file pkg/PLIST (in place of dead revision 1.9) cvs server: use 'cvs commit' to add these files permanently The following step is optional, it gets rid of the empty patches/ directory - but that doesn't hurt. You could also do that after commit, or not at all. $ cvs up -dP cvs server: Updating . A Makefile A distinfo cvs server: Updating patches cvs server: Updating pkg A pkg/DESCR A pkg/PLIST $ find . | rs # another plausibility check . ./CVS/Entries.Log ./pkg/CVS/Entries ./CVS ./pkg ./pkg/DESCR ./CVS/Root ./pkg/CVS ./pkg/PLIST ./CVS/Repository ./pkg/CVS/Root ./Makefile ./CVS/Entries ./pkg/CVS/Repository ./distinfo Now is the best time for a brief, final testing of the port, to make sure you used the right tarball etc. etc. $ cvs commit Yours, Ingo
